When ss12 download on social media sites it caches the file locally and, if so, where is it?

I downloaded some videos on Vimeo, but I also want to keep the file made locally; However, I can't find out where it could be if a copy is kept locally.  I looked in the directory "C:\Users\Rich\AppData\Roaming\Adobe\Common\Media Cache Files" and do not see it there.

Somewhere this file must exist, at least until the download is complete, and then maybe it is deleted first.  I don't want to wait and download the file from Vimeo because they monkey with the video before they post it.

Thanks in advance for any wisdom.

Rich

Rich,

When using the method of direct download, the only file that exists is on Vimeo, FaceBook, etc...

Instead of making direct download, instead use Publish + share to create an output file, with the specifications. It must, then download it manually on the social media site - giving you this file on your computer, as well. This method also allows to work around some limitations of the direct method, for example file duration extended accounts.

  • When I download a jpg in Photoshop elements Editor, the file is stored in Documents & Settings / My Name/Local Settings/Temp but I can't find this place on my computer.

    The photos are attached to e-mail messages. I can go as far as documents and settings and my name, but he has not shown Local Settings folder. With the help of MS search with the name of the file does nothing. I use Windows XP and Mozilla Firefox. The file appears in Photoshop Elements and I can save it as a psd file, but I can't find the jpg or psd files to move in my images.

    The Local Settings folder is a hidden folder.

    (1) if the file appears in the download (Tools menu or Ctrl + j) Manager, you can right-click and open the folder that contains access it directly.

    (2) in order to see the folders hidden Windows XP in general, try this:

    Open my computer or Windows Explorer

    Tools > Folder Options > view tab

    Scroll down and look for the box on the hidden files and folders and display them.

    I hope that this will solve the problem. A little luck?

    (3) in addition, you may be able to save images from the e-mail message to a more convenient location by double-clicking on the links and Save Link As (before you open them for editing.)

  • Error when you try to play audio files: Windows Media Player cannot access the file. The file may be in use, you won't have access to the computer where the file is stored

    Windows Media Player cannot access the file. The file may be in use, you won't have access to the computer on which the file is stored, or your proxy settings are may not be incorrect.

    I hope someone can help on Win 7 64 bit, music is taken on a disk usb2 external hard... I had no problem until today when the message in the title appeared next to each track, with a little red cross.

    I already deleted database library as suggested by some of the forums, also disabled the media as a feature of Win 7, rebooted and then re-enabled it.  I also disconnected externally and restarted that as well, I'm also the same mistake with a cd in the cd drive as well.

    Can anyone help?

    Hello

    This error may occur for one of the following reasons:
    The file is currently in use. Close the file and then try again.

    You are not allowed to access the location where the file is stored.

    Follow these steps to grant all permissions in the folder where the files are stored:
    1. right click on the folder on the external drive and click Properties.
    2. in the Properties window, click on Security tab.
    3. now, click Edit , and then click Add.
    4. now, type everyone in the box and click OK.
    5. check the full control box.
    6. click on apply and then click OK.

    You can also try the mentioned below as follows:

    1. click on start.
    2. go in Control Panel.
    3. Select "SOUND".
    4. double-click on speakers.
    5. click on the tab advanced and then uncheck the enable audio enhancements.
